Richmond just got a sweet new retro HK street snack spot.
After months of waiting, longtime dessert joint Snackshot has officially soft opened its newest location inside Continental Shopping Centre on March 28th.
You might remember back in October 2024 when we reported about how they’re relocating from Granville to Richmond.

If you’ve never been, Snackshot isn’t just about desserts.
The family-run business has been serving iconic Hong Kong-style sweets and snacks since 2017, with dishes like curry fish balls, siu mai, and chewy rice rolls drenched in peanut butter and soy sauce.
They’re also the ones behind those viral Mahjong Tile desserts that blew up Instagram—yes, those are still on the menu here, along with their signature bulldog drinks, sweet soups, peach gum, and HK-style beverages.
Their new Richmond location has completely transformed a former hair salon into what looks like a retro HK alleyway, complete with vintage signage, Supreme skateboard decks, and a wall of mahjong tiles.
Like their other locations, you’ll find nostalgic characters and toys scattered around that gives each part of the shop something to inspect.
And to celebrate their soft opening, from March 28 to April 3 you can get tofu pudding for $1 with any purchase while quantities last.
Hours during the week are very night market-coded: Monday to Thursday, 7pm to 12am, and Friday to Sunday, 3pm to 12am.
